Hi,
DSA just did whatever was needed so that d-i.debian.org is available
over https as well as over http (with a redirection from the latter to
the former).
I've already patched:
- debian-installer (there's still a hit when grepping there but I'm not
too happy with touching the contents of an old talk);
- netboot-assistant;
- win32-loader.
Remaining hits (according to codesearch):
- debian-cd;
- live-build;
- virt-manager.
I'll file bug reports shortly for those.
I expect a few hiccups with scripts running on dillon (given the https
dance we have to do when running on debian.org machines), which I'll try
to notice/fix as they happen, over the upcoming hours/days.
